基于改进型树型奇偶机的密钥交换研究
Research on Key Exchange Based on Improved Tree Parity Machine
摘要
Abstract
This paper proposes a key exchange method based on improved tree parity machine.The pseudo-random number generator is used to generate common input vectors for both sides of communication,so as to reduce the amount of data needed in network synchronization.Sliding window based learning rules are used to dynamically change the learning rate,so as to reduce the number of synchronization.Furthermore,an efficient input sequence generation method based on knapsack algorithm and depth first search traversal algorithm is proposed to increase the positive learning probability and accelerate the synchronization speed.The sim-ulation results show that the communication data volume of the improved model is reduced by more than 60%,and the synchroniza-tion time is significantly reduced.关键词
